Over 3.2 million students have access to preferential loans
Nearly 9 years after the implementation of the credit program for pupils and students based on Decision 157/2007/QD-TTg by the Prime Minister, over 3.2 million pupils and students have been given preferential loans worth over VND25 trillion from the Vietnam Bank for Social Policies (VBSP).

According to the VPSP, the policy holds great economic and socio-political significance and has created a very positive consensus within the communities.
It reflects the right guideline of the Party and the policy of the Government towards credit for pupils and students, which meets the aspiration of people and the development of society.
The program also helps to reduce poverty and social welfare requirements by creating greater equality in education and providing the country’s human resource pool with greater opportunities to exploit socio-economic development.
At present, each pupil and student can borrow VND1.1 million per month at an interest of 0,55% per month.
